Marks and reviews

92

/100

Decanter

Presents lovely aromas of passion fruit, nectarine and lemon peel, then opens up with hints of acacia and beeswax on the palate. The texture is taut and dynamic with lively acidity that gives the wine both depth and length. The grapes are from four parcels under the Vaillons umbrella: one in Chatains and three in Roncières; all share a southeast exposition. They are lightly crushed and fermented on native yeasts in casks, mostly of 500 to 600 litres.

Description

Characteristics and Tasting Notes for the Chablis 1er Cru "Les Vaillons Vieilles Vignes" 2024 from Domaine Laroche

Tasting

Nose
The bouquet reveals itself as particularly complex and intense, its aromatic concentration heightened by the very low yields of the year. It opens with a great freshness of citrus, accompanied by a slight reduction that gives it plenty of energy.

Palate
On the palate, this cru stands out through remarkable tension and a distinctly "steely" profile. The attack is lively and citrusy, revealing a firm structure sculpted by minerality. The finish, persistent and dynamic, points to remarkable potential.

Food and Wine Pairings

The citrusy tension and minerality of this cru pair beautifully with pan-seared scallops. It also shines alongside white meats in creamy sauces, such as veal blanquette, as well as matured cheeses like Comté, Brie or Chaource.

Serving and Cellaring

Displaying lovely energy and a slight reduction in its youth, this Chablis 1er Cru "Les Vaillons Vieilles Vignes" 2024 will benefit from a little aeration or a few years of cellaring to fully open up. Its taut structure ensures excellent ageing potential.

The tension and rarity of a great white Chablis wine by Domaine Laroche

The Estate

Founded in 1850 by Jean-Victor Laroche, Domaine Laroche is a historic figure of Chablis, in Burgundy. Now owned by the AdVini group and led by Jean-Baptiste Mouton, the estate spans 90 hectares of vines in Chablis and 40 hectares in Languedoc. Its identity is deeply rooted in the Obédiencerie, a former 9th-century monastery where the wine has been aged for over a thousand years. A pioneer in agro-ecology, the estate has been HVE 3 certified since 2016 and stands out for its biodiversity-focused approach, illustrated by its philosophy of entrusting each plot to a single dedicated person.

The Vineyard

The Climat Les Vaillons is an early-ripening, sun-drenched terroir in Chablis, facing south and east within an open, well-ventilated valley. The estate cultivates a 2.17-hectare plot here, made up of old vines aged between 60 and 65 years. Deeply rooted in stony soils resting on Kimmeridgian marl and limestone, these vines benefit from rigorous agro-ecological management. The soils are maintained without any herbicides, protected by natural plant cover, and the plant material comes from massale selection to preserve the diversity and health of the vineyard.

The Vintage

2024 proved particularly challenging for this plot of old vines, which suffered significant hail damage. This major weather event caused considerable stress to the vines and drastically reduced the harvest, limiting yields to around 20 hectolitres per hectare. These difficult weather conditions thus shaped an extremely rare vintage, characterised by very low production but exceptional concentration in the grapes.

Winemaking and Ageing

Although the precise details of the cellar work for this particular year have not yet been fully revealed, the Chablis 1er Cru "Les Vaillons Vieilles Vignes" 2024 was tasted while still ageing, from barrel samples. Traditionally for this cuvée, the estate favours vinification combining stainless steel tanks and French oak barrels, followed by ageing on fine lees to preserve the purity of the fruit while adding complexity.

Grape Variety

This wine is made exclusively from Chardonnay (100%).
